Hello,

Would I need the extension if I'm going to fit 31 10.5 r15 tyres?

In short the answer is yes.

If your fitting tyres that stick out further than the side of the wheel arch, i.e. with the top of the tread showing, then that is illegal in the UK. You will therefore need to fit wheel arch extensions, to cover them.
If your fitting wheel arch extensions, then the sliding door will probably not be able to open properly, so you would need to fit the sliding door extension.
